10 Top Cloudflare Alternatives for Your Website
Even on the DDoS protection and security front, CDN77 is considered up to the task due largely to the automatic detection and blocking mechanism. It comes with a proprietary Hurricane DDoS solution based on DPDK which helps it monitor traffic, keep a track of attacks and block them fast. The reliable content protection coupled with a host of access management features...
Source: beebom.com
11 Best CDN Providers To Speed Up A Website
CDN77 is known as an innovation frontrunner for deploying the newest features as soon as possible – such as HTTP/2, Brotli compression or TLS 1.3. There is no surprise why it is counted among the best CDN services in the market today.
Source: mofluid.com
The best CDN providers of 2018 to speed up any website
You get a free Let's Encrypt SSL certificate, and CDN77 is pretty good value for money overall in terms of its per-GB pricing, although it’s not the cheapest outfit we’ve highlighted here. Pricing starts at $0.045 per GB of data for US and European locations, with Asia and Latin America being more expensive. If you want to test the waters, there’s a 14-day risk-free trial,...
